# q-bonsai-27b — Bonsai-27B as a κ-object (the full 27B mind, streamed like a film)
**Created using [Bonsai](https://huggingface.co/prism-ml/Bonsai-27B-gguf) by Prism ML.**
This is [prism-ml/Bonsai-27B](https://huggingface.co/prism-ml/Bonsai-27B-gguf) — a 27-billion-parameter
hybrid-attention model (Qwen3.5 family: 16 full-attention + 48 gated-delta linear layers) moved
end-to-end into **binary {−1,+1} weights (1.125 true bits/weight, embeddings and LM head included)**
re-laid as a **content-addressed κ-object** for the [Hologram](https://github.com/Hologram-Technologies)
serverless substrate. **No re-quantization anywhere**: the trained sign bits pass through byte-exact.
## What's here
| File | What it is |
|---|---|
| `q-bonsai-27b.v1.holo` | ONE Range-streamable file: boot-ordered BLAKE3-verified blocks + embedded tokenizer, lm_head packed early so a progressive reader serves the decode-critical path first. |
| `manifest.json` + `b/*.gz` | The same 803 blocks as loose content-addressed parts (sha256 transport axis) — the parallel-fetch fast path on CDN origins. |
| `manifest.blake3.json` + `sha256-to-blake3.map.json` | The canonical BLAKE3 (κ) axis. |
| `tokenizer.gguf` | The source GGUF header (tokenizer + arch), for serverless load. |
Every block is verified against its content address **before** it is decompressed or touches the
GPU. Any static file host serving these bytes is an equal origin — the bytes, not the host, carry
identity.

## Architecture (from the GGUF header)
64 blocks, d=5120, ff=17408, vocab 248320; `full_attention_interval=4` → 16 full-attention layers
(24 heads × 256, 4 KV heads, per-head q/k RMSNorm, gated output) + 48 linear layers (gated-delta
SSM: conv kernel 4, state 128, 16 groups, dt-rank 48, inner 6144); MRoPE sections [11,11,10,0],
rope base 1e7; 262K trained context.
## Provenance
Weights: Prism ML's Bonsai-27B (Apache-2.0) — see `LICENSE` and `NOTICE.txt`.
Conversion: `compile2bit.mjs q1` pass-through + `holo-kappa-pack.mjs` (Hologram Q substrate).
Format `q1`: blob = `[signs N·K/8 B][f32 scales N·K/128·4 B]` per tensor; the GEMV kernel
dequantizes inside the matmul. Browser engine support for the hybrid architecture is in
active development on the Hologram substrate; the 8B sibling
([HOLOGRAMTECH/q-bonsai-8b](https://huggingface.co/HOLOGRAMTECH/q-bonsai-8b)) runs live today.
